Sabian 20" HHX Chinese vs 20" HHX COMPLEX AERO CRASH

The HHX Chinese is a traditional-voiced crash optimized for rock and metal with aggressive attack and quick projection, while the HHX Complex Aero Crash blends articulate snap with dark, complex lows and works across rock, jazz, and progressive styles. Choose the Chinese for hard-hitting, cutting tones in heavy genres; choose the Complex Aero for versatility and sonic depth across multiple playing contexts.

Why choose Sabian 20" HHX Chinese

  • Aggressive, cutting attack and pinpoint projection ideal for rock and metal
  • Traditional Chinese cymbal character with authentic voice
  • Medium-thin weight offers quick decay and fast articulation
  • Large flanged lip provides edge definition and sustain

Why choose 20" HHX COMPLEX AERO CRASH

  • Versatile across rock, jazz, and progressive styles
  • Boosted highs via Aero hole design with deep, dark lows for complex tone
  • Quite thin, loose construction delivers fast decay and immediate response
  • HHX Complex character adds sweetness and sophistication without generic brightness
Bottom line: Pick the HHX Chinese if you play aggressive rock, metal, or hard rock and want straightforward cutting power and traditional character. Pick the HHX Complex Aero Crash if you need a 20-inch crash that handles multiple genres and demands sonic complexity alongside clarity.

Frequently asked questions

Which crash works better for jazz and progressive music?

The HHX Complex Aero Crash is specifically listed for jazz and progressive styles, offering the dark, complex tones those genres value. The HHX Chinese is optimized for rock and metal and is not ideal for jazz.

What is the key tonal difference between these two 20-inch crashes?

The HHX Chinese emphasizes aggressive attack, cutting sustain, and quick decay with traditional character. The HHX Complex Aero Crash balances cutting highs (boosted by the Aero hole) with deep, dark lows and complex sweetness for a more nuanced sound.

Are both suitable for studio and live performance?

Yes, both are listed for studio sessions and live performance. The HHX Chinese prioritizes pinpoint projection in a mix, while the HHX Complex Aero Crash excels in controlled studio settings and high-energy live contexts with its responsive, articulate character.

Which is better for a heavy metal drummer?

The HHX Chinese is explicitly recommended for metal and hard rock with its aggressive attack and cutting sustain. The HHX Complex Aero Crash is listed as not ideal for heavy metal, making the Chinese the clear choice for that style.
